For the 2025-26 school year, there is 1 public school serving 658 students in 33367, FL.
The top-ranked public school in 33367, FL is Terrace Community Middle School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Public school in zipcode 33367 have an average math proficiency score of 92% (versus the Florida public school average of 52%), and reading proficiency score of 90% (versus the 52% statewide average).
Minority enrollment is 76% of the student body (majority Asian), which is more than the Florida public school average of 66% (majority Hispanic).
